ANC members in the Peter Mokaba Region are up in arms against the region's Task Team, accusing them of destroying the party by allowing irregularities to occur under their leadership. The members have expressed their discontentment and disappointment, citing the team's failure to address branch registration issues and disputes.
The ANC members said that the Task Team has allowed parallel branches with questionable Branch General Meetings (BGMs) to mushroom in the region. These fake parallel structures have been created through unorthodox means, including the scanning of IDs of members not present at BGMs and even the scanning of deceased individuals' IDs to reach quorum.
Out of 103 branches that qualified in the Peter Mokaba Region, 49 branches are disputed due to failure to adhere to BGM guidelines, parallel packages, and other irregularities.
The ANC members are calling for the dismissal of the Peter Mokaba Region Task Team, citing gross violations of the ANC constitution. They demand that ANC Secretary-General Fikile Mbalula takes decisive action to address these issues and charge the Task Team with misconduct.
The ANC members have also demanded that the upcoming conference, scheduled for this weekend, be postponed. They argue that the conference cannot proceed under the current circumstances, where the legitimacy of the delegates and the branches they represent are in question.
This is not the first time the ANC in Limpopo has faced internal disputes. Recently, the party's Veterans League and ANC Youth League joined forces to demand disciplinary action against former MP Boy Mamabolo for insulting and questioning the moral standing of ANCWL NEC member Onnica Kwakwa.
The ANC members' discontent reflects a deeper crisis within the party. "We can no longer trust the Task Team to lead our region. They have failed to uphold the values and principles of our party, and it's time for them to go," said disgruntled ANC members.
Meanwhile The Azanian can confirm to its readers and followers that their key demands are;
*The ANC members demand that the Peter Mokaba Region Task Team be dismissed immediately.
*The members call for disciplinary action against the Task Team for grossly violating the ANC constitution.
*The conference scheduled for this weekend should be postponed until the issues are resolved.
*A new Task Team should be appointed to oversee the region's affairs and ensure the party's values and principles are upheld.
